THE JAZZ MESSAGE CELEBRATING ART BLAKEY FEAT. JAVON JACKSON, EDDIE HENDERSON, STEVE TURRE, BENNY GREEN, BUSTER WILLIAMS, LEWIS NASH (SUN)
From Art Blakey's legendary original ensemble, we meet the saxophonist Javon Jackson and trumpeter Eddie Henderson, pianist Benny Green. In addition, the trombonist Steve Turre who has been voted the best trombonist five times by Down Beat readers; Buster Williams who among others was the bass player in Herbie Hancock's Mwandishi Sextet and in the Ron Carter Quartet, drummer Lewis Nash, who was picked up by Betty Carter's band as a 22 year old and subsequently played with almost everyone and everything, Sonny Rollins, Willie Nelson, and Diana Krall.
So many renowned jazz musicians on stage at the same time is a luxury. Their initiated tribute to the king of hard bop can’t be anything other than a jazz fest of seldom seen proportions.
